Steward's Report - October 18, 2025

October 18, 2025

Keeneland Race 10

A Stewards Inquiry was posted involving fourth place #11 “Liam’s Latte” (Victor Espinoza) and eighth place #9 “Unlikely Queen” (Gabriel Saez) near the 1/16 pole. After reviewing the race replay and interviewing the riders, the stewards determined that #11 angled in towards the rail while not clear, causing #9 to clip heels and steady. For the interference, #11 was disqualified from fourth and placed eighth, behind #9.

Official order of finish: 7-1-3-2-13

Safety Report October 11, 2025

SAfety report October 11, 2025

Race 1

Following an incident in Race 1 involving Cielo and jockey Flavien Prat, both were promptly attended to on-track by Keeneland’s equine safety and UK HealthCare medical teams. Due to the severity of the injury, humane euthanasia was elected in the best interest of the horse. Our heartfelt condolences go out to Cielo’s connections.

Jockey Flavien Prat was evaluated by UK HealthCare and cleared to ride. 

Safety Report October 10, 2025

Safety Report October 10, 2025

Race 6

There was an incident in Race 6 involving Gotta Lotta Tempo and jockey Tyler Gaffalione. Both were immediately attended to on-track. Due to the severity of the injury, humane euthanasia was elected in the best interest of the horse. Tyler Gaffalione was evaluated by UKHC medical staff and cleared to ride.

We express our sincere condolences to the connections of Gotta Lotta Tempo.

Safety Report October 8, 2025

Safety Report October 8, 2025

Race 4

Jockey Chris Landeros was unseated at the start aboard #2 Unbridled’s Map in Race 4. He was evaluated by UK HealthCare medical staff and cleared to ride. Unbridled’s Map was examined and appears to be in good order.

For precautionary reasons #5 Tully was given a courtesy ride back to the barn after the gallop-out returning from the race at the instruction of the state veterinarian. He appeared to have pulled a shoe and is walking the shedrow and cooling out comfortably. He continues to be monitored by his attending veterinarian.
